Question regarding Bookmarks

Is there a way to maintain drill down status in the bookmark and accept filters from the previous page/bookmark?

 

For example, I have a matrix with different time views--there are drill downs for Month and Year and the metrics change based on the drill down (month over month, year over year).  If the user chooses a filter value, they should be able to go back and forth between the pages/bookmarks without loosing the filter, and the drilldown state should be maintained.  Is this possible?

  • Hi Jansco 

    "If the user chooses a filter value, they should be able to go back and forth between the pages/bookmarks without loosing the filter",

    for this requirement, it is possible with synchronized filters.

     

    "the drilldown state should be maintained",

    I'm afraid drilldown state doesn't sync among reports/bookmarks, you may consider using Drillthrough filtering in this case instead of bookmarks.
